When a FiiO E07K or E17 not included is plugged into the dock on the E09K, the USB input on the back of the E09K becomes active, and the combination becomes a formidable digital-to-analog converter, suitable for streaming hi-res files from a computer. I did a research on which studio mixing headphones to buy for my RME Baby, since my old cans are simply not on par with my new converters, plus the impedance dumping factor is too low.. I am most inclining towards buying the Austrian AKG Q, Quincy Jones edition, mostly due to their reputation of being balanced and true to the sound put into them I am no basshead, you know The dumping ratio is only , while - according to some - it should be anywhere near the factor.
Again, I have not much experience with impedance issues, that's why I am rather asking prior to buying the cans themselves. From what I found out on the internet, with inadequately chosen headphone impedance, the following unpleasant things might occur: - even the most balanced phones ever made might get uneven frequency responses some claim a 30 Ohm amp driving their phones adds as much as 24db to the 30KHz frequency!
Please advise on how to proceed to pair RME baby with Qs so that the impedance matches perfectly. Here are the solution to the problem that come to my mind: 1. Buy a headphone amp that accepts line input signals, mirrors them to a corresponding line outputs, plus amplifies the signal for the Q phones with 8Ohm output impedance - since this impedance level seems to be right for Q I checked some recommended options, ran into Fiio amps , but these seem to be using the digital source from the computer as their input - I already have RME converters and dont want to burden my Mac's CPU with another converter just for headphones.
Same insight plea as in point one. Buy another headphone. With Pros, the impedance is matched to perfection - Ohms would get me just the dumping factor. Isn't this too high? Build a DIY headphone attenuator. Again, no experience with these little buddies on my side.
If anyone has any insights here, please let me know. Buy a headphone attenuator. No clue where and which would be suitable. Same as above. Thanks guys for every insight. Third, this is not answering the question. The question was about impedance compatibility. I have the Babyface. I plan on buying the Q Since the q are low impedance cans 62Ohm and since the Babyface headphone out is mid-to-high impedance 30Ohm , the performance of the headphones is downgraded when plugged directly into the headphone out of the interface. The question was how to solve this impedance mismatch, and whether the particular FIIO phone amp model above can be the right solution for it.
